Patient representative

Duties and responsibilities                        

Patient Representatives work for healthcare administrators to address the concerns and special needs of patients and their families. They evaluate patient satisfaction and investigate complaints or they collect information about patient’s dissatisfaction. They work in hospitals, nursing homes, and other long term care facilities.

Average salary: $20,000 - $40,000

Educational requirements:


Students should take challenging high school courses in business, science, and math and in English. Most employees prefer college graduates with backgrounds in health or social services.
